摘要
A 22-year-old male who had Mustard repair for complete transposition presented with progressive exercise intolerance, documented by a gradual decrease in exercise capacity on cycle ergometer. Cardiac catheterization and angiography demonstrated subvalvular pulmonary stenosis. After surgical relief of the obstruction, exercise capacity returned to previous level.
